*** THIS DATE IN #REDS HISTORY! MAY 28 *** May 28, 1981 - Johnny Bench broke his left ankle in bottom of the seventh inning of #Reds game on May 28, 1981. This couldnt have come as a worse time for Johnny, he had stopped catching, was playing first base and hitting for a very high average....as i recall from that time, he was pretty much platooning with Dan Driessen, then Driessen got hurt as he often did, but didnt matter, johnny was very close to outright stealing dannys job....bad break. Born in Cincinnati in 1958, Doran was a local product who attended Mt. Healthy High School and Miami University. He was originally drafted by Houston in the 6th round of the 1979 draft, but he was traded to the Reds on August 30, 1990 in exchange for catcher Terry McGriff and minor league pitchers Keith Kaiser and Butch Henry. BONUS GAME : (usually a REDS loss) - May 28, 2003 - Rafael Furcal, Mark DeRosa and Gary Sheffield hit home runs off Cincinnati Reds pitcher Jeff Austin, who, incidentally, is appearing in his final major league game, in the bottom of the 1st inning, as the Atlanta Braves become only the second team in major league history to begin a game with three consecutive home runs. On April 13, 1987, Marvell Wynne, Tony Gwynn and John Kruk of the San Diego Padres did the same in the bottom of the 1st inning off San Francisco starter Roger Mason.
